What a Vibratory Screen Does in a Recycling Plant

A vibratory screen is a sloped deck of punched plate, wire mesh, or urethane panels that vibrates as material flows across it. The vibration conveys material down the deck and stratifies the bed — small pieces sink, find the openings, and fall through, while oversize carries over the end. Every vibratory screen for recycling does some version of that one job — scalping oversize ahead of a sort line, pulling abrasive fines out early, sizing a finished product to spec, or spreading material a single layer deep ahead of optical sorters. Screening by Material Stream

What a screen contributes — and what has to be built around it — depends on the material. These are the streams where vibratory screening most often earns its place in a recycling or waste processing line.

Glass Cullet

Screening cullet sizes the glass for market and pulls out the fines, labels, and cap fragments that lower its value. Glass is also the hardest stream on the equipment around the screen — abrasive, prone to packing, quick to work under belt edges. Compost & Organics

For compost and ground organics, screening turns a pile into a product — the deck passes finished compost at the specified particle size while overs, uncomposted wood, and contaminants such as film plastic carry over for reprocessing or disposal. Organics are heavy, wet, and hard on light-gauge equipment, so the infeed and takeaway conveyors around the screen matter as much as the screen itself.

C&D Fines

In construction and demolition processing, a screen pulls the fines fraction — soil, gravel, gypsum dust, and small aggregate — out of the mixed stream early, before those abrasive fines ride through the plant grinding on belts and bearings. Screening first also leaves cleaner oversize for the pickers and separators downstream, so the sort line works on material worth sorting.

Scrap

On shredded scrap, screening separates fines from the sized fraction ahead of magnetic and eddy current separation, so each separator sees material in the size range it handles best. Adding a Screen to an Existing Line

A vibratory screen can usually be retrofitted into a line that is already running. Three things have to be engineered: drop height, because material needs room to stratify and discharge into whatever comes next; structure, because a vibrating machine cannot simply sit on the existing floor steel; and material flow, because the conveyors feeding and following the screen usually need rework so each fraction has somewhere to go. Which materials screen well on a vibratory screen?

Vibratory screens work best on free-flowing material where particle size separates the product — glass cullet, mixed container streams, compost and ground organics, C&D fines, and shredded scrap are all common. Material that mats, tangles, or wraps, such as film-heavy single stream, can blind a vibrating deck and may be better served by a disc screen or another separation step.
